What is WooCommerce Hosting?
A WooCommerce hosting is a web hosting specifically designed to serve online stores using the WooCommerce plugin for WordPress. It is e-commerce ooptimisedunlike the regular hosting, which is designed to handle product pages, shopping carts, secure payment, and customer data effectively.
WooCommerce hosting is an online store-friendly, high-speed, and secure hosting. It guarantees rapid siteloading, transactions, and effective uptime a,, all of which are essential in operating a successful eCommerce business.
Whereas WordPress hosting is for blog-oriented or general websites, WooCommerce hosting is aimed at online stores. It has better performance, superior security for transactions, and characteristics such as inventory support, external payment gateway optimisation, and order management. Simply stated, WooCommerce hosting, when paired with a reliable Ecommerce website builder, provides your eCommerce store with the power and reliability that cannot be found in regular WordPress hosting.
When choosing WooCommerce hosting, look for:
- High performance and speed optimisation for faster checkouts.
- Free SSL certificate for secure transactions.
- Automatic backups to protect store data.
- Scalability to handle seasonal or festive traffic.
- Pre-installed WooCommerce setup for easy launching.
- 24/7 expert support from WooCommerce specialists.

How to Choose the Best WooCommerce Hosting: Factors to Consider
The choice of the appropriate WooCommerce hosting is not only about the price but also the possibility of finding the balance between performance, reliability, and scalability. These are the main considerations to make before your selection:
- Speed and Performance: Speed is directly related to user experience and conversions. Select hosting with SSD or NVMe storage, built-in caching, and CDN support so that your store loads fast even during periods of high traffic.
- Uptime Guarantee: A host must increase the minimum uptime by 99.9. Downtime translates to lost income and client loyalty, and hence, one should always select a provider that has a good track record of reliability.
- Security Features: eCommerce stores deal with vital information. To ensure that the information of your customers is safe, your hosting should contain some features of SSL, malwarnd firewalls and regular backups.
- Scalability: You may need more or less scale as your store grows. Select a provider that can easily upgrade with the increase of traffic or products to be sold without deceleration.
- Customer support: Technical problems may occur at any moment in time. Available 24/7 via live chat, phone, or email is guaranteed so that your store is always online.
- Pricing/Value: Cheap hosting does not necessarily work. Compare the advantages of various plans in terms of what you receive (bandwidth, storage, security and support) to establish the most advantageous deals in the long run.
- WooCommerce Optimisation: Not all WordPress hosts are optimised for WooCommerce. Seek those having inbuilt caching in the WooCommerce, those with specialised assistance on the use of the bothers to update without difficulties and those having staging to facilitate the smooth updates.
